About the Webinar

The COVID-19 outbreak, coupled with the economic downturn and shift to online commerce, has resulted in the increasing closure of businesses operating in the “bricks and mortar” space. The Federal Government is expecting landlords and tenants to negotiate a fair way forward, however what does this mean in practice? The NSW Government has also announced a range of measures to assist landlords and tenants.

This session will provide practical guidance on managing key changes in tenancy arrangements, with a focus on the new mandatory Commercial Leases Code of Conduct and the newly released Retail and Other Commercial Leases (COVID-19) Regulation 2020, and advise on proactive steps to take to protect landlords in times of uncertainty, including:

  • The different ways a tenant can end the lease early – surrender, breach, mutual agreement
  • Achieving a win/win: assignment, sub-letting and licensing options to assist the tenant
  • Negotiating fair outcomes – what does this look like?
  • Receiving or giving notice – form and content, and other legislative obligations
  • Dispute resolution options
  • Right of entry, make good and forfeiture
  • The Retail and Other Commercial Leases (COVID-19) Regulation 2020
  • Unpacking the Commercial Leases Code of Conduct – how will it apply in NSW?
  • NSW land tax concessions for landlords
  • Case studies on lease termination
  • Proactive risk management – protecting the interests of landlord and tenant through reasonable negotiations and fair leasing terms
